If the driving experience during the day largely depends on power, then the driving experience at night is closely related to the headlights.

Although manufacturers promote them in various ways, there are only two mainstream types of headlight structures – the reflective bowl type and the lens type.

The structure of the reflector bowl for low light often requires a large-sized lamp cavity

The reflective bowl structure projects the light from the light source onto the road surface in the desired shape through a reflective structure. The front material of the reflective bowl is similar to that of a mirror, so the reflection efficiency is extremely high and the brightness loss is small. This is beneficial for extending the illumination distance. Therefore, for halogen light source vehicles with insufficient brightness, the reflective bowl structure is particularly suitable. Most vehicle models also adopt reflective bowl-type high beams to increase the illumination distance of the high beams.

The Mercedes-Benz GLC also adopts a high beam reflector bowl structure

However, one drawback of the reflective bowl is that its headlights do not look exquisite enough and lack a high sense of class. Secondly, the uniformity of the light distribution is not good enough. As a low beam light, it often cannot evenly illuminate the road surface. Therefore, the reflective bowl-shaped structure is often not used as a low beam light.

Lens projector

Compared with the reflector bowl type, the lens type structure is much more advanced. The lens type headlight also has a reflector bowl inside, but with a glass lens structure added. After adding the glass lens, on the one hand, the light concentration is better, and the upper tangent line of the low beam is clearer. On the other hand, the light irradiation is more uniform. However, due to the problem of light transmittance of the glass lens, Therefore, the illumination distance is often not as simple and straightforward as that of the reflector bowl type. Thus, the lens type is often used as a low beam lamp.

Simply put, low-end cars prefer the reflector bowl type, while high-end cars favor the lens type. High beams are more commonly reflector bowl type, while low beams are more suitable for lens type.
